A cylindrical of wood (density `= 600 kg m^(-3)`) of base area `30 cm^(2)` and height `54 cm`, floats in a liquid of density `900 kg^(-3)` The block is displaced slightly and then released. The time period of the resulting oscillations of the block would be equal to that of a simple pendulum of length (nearly) :

A

`26 cm`

B

`52 cm`

C

`36cm`

D

`65 cm`

Text Solution

Verified by Experts

The correct Answer is:
C

If the block is displaced further by small distance form equilibrium
extra buyont force = mass xx acceleration
`rArr - rho_(L) Axg = rho_(b)Ah(d^(2)x)/(dt^(2))`
`(d^(2)x)/(dt^(2)) = - ((g)/(36))x`
`rArr omega^(2) = (g)/(36)`
for simple pendulum,
`omega^(2) = (g)/(L)`
comparing we get., `L = 36 cm`
